Bug Description

Binary package hint: indicator-sound

Instead of highlighting whenever the mouse is over the slider, it highlights when the mouse is on the top ~half of the slider, or within about half the slider's height above it. See attached video for example.

mannheim (kronheim) wrote :

This bug has a nasty side-effect. When the mouse is over the slider and slider is not highlighted (because of this bug), if the user does a mouse-down, then the slider moves right (increasing volume) and continues to do so until the mouse is released.

I am often trying to reduce the volume by grabbing the slider with the mouse, only to find that the slider "runs away" from me, to the right. (This is with lucid's current version of indicator-sound.)
